2575
2575 is a odd composite number that follows 2574 and precedes 2576. It is composed of 6 distinct factors: 1, 5, 25, 103, 515, 2575. Its prime factorization can be written as 5^2 × 103. 2575 is classified as a deficient number based on the sum of its proper divisors. In computer science, 2575 is represented as 101000001111 in binary and A0F in hexadecimal. Historically, it is written as MMDLXXV in Roman numerals.
